Joe Thuney’s new team is handing him a new deal.

Thuney and the Bears have agreed to a two-year extension, per the guard’s agent, Mike McCartney. The new two-year deal is worth $35 million, and Thuney will make $51 million over the next three years with $33.5 million guaranteed at signing, NFL Network Insiders Ian Rapoport and Tom Pelissero reported on Tuesday, per sources.

Set to make $16 million on the final year of his contract, Thuney was already making top-five money among left guards in the NFL (and 12th among all guards) prior to this extension, per Over The Cap. His new deal propels him to $17 million per year, ranking fourth among left guards and 10th among all guards.
